Apakah antara muka generik?
Apakah antara muka generik?

Video: Apakah antara muka generik?

Video: Apakah antara muka generik?
Video: OBAT PATEN VS OBAT GENERIK, MENDING MANA? - PODKES (Pokoknya Obrolan Dunia Kesehatan) 2024, April
Anonim

Antara muka yang diisytiharkan dengan jenis parametersbecome antara muka generik . Antara muka generik mempunyai dua tujuan yang sama seperti biasa antara muka . Mereka sama ada dicipta untuk mendedahkan ahli kelas yang akan digunakan oleh kelas lain, atau untuk memaksa kelas melaksanakan fungsi khusus.

Juga, apakah antara muka generik dalam Java?

Generik antara muka ditentukan sama seperti generik kelas. Contohnya: MyInterface ialah a antara muka generik yang mengisytiharkan kaedah yang dipanggil myMethod(). Secara umumnya, a antara muka generik diisytiharkan dengan cara yang sama seperti a generik kelas.

bagaimana anda menggunakan generik? Secara ringkas, generik membolehkan jenis (kelas dan antara muka) menjadi parameter apabila mentakrifkan kelas, antara muka dan kaedah. Sama seperti parameter formal yang lebih biasa digunakan dalam pengisytiharan kaedah, parameter taip menyediakan cara untuk anda guna kod yang sama dengan input yang berbeza.

Begitu juga, apakah itu kelas generik?

Definisi: “A generik jenis ialah a kelas generik atau antara muka yang diparameterkan mengikut jenis.” Pada asasnya, generik jenis membolehkan anda menulis umum, kelas generik (atau kaedah) yang berfungsi dengan jenis yang berbeza, membenarkan penggunaan semula kod.

Apakah tujuan kekangan antara muka pada parameter jenis?

Klausa where dalam definisi generik menentukan kekangan pada jenis yang digunakan sebagai hujah untuk jenis parameter secara generik taip , kaedah, perwakilan atau setempat fungsi . Kekangan boleh nyatakan antara muka , kelas asas, atau memerlukan generik taip menjadi rujukan, nilai, orunmanaged taip.

Disyorkan: